Update app.py
Browse files
app.py
CHANGED
|
@@ -9,7 +9,7 @@ from nltk.tokenize import word_tokenize
|
|
| 9 |
from nltk.corpus import stopwords
|
| 10 |
from nltk.stem import WordNetLemmatizer
|
| 11 |
# Download necessary resources
|
| 12 |
-
nltk.download('
|
| 13 |
nltk.download('stopwords')
|
| 14 |
nltk.download('wordnet')
|
| 15 |
|
|
@@ -28,20 +28,26 @@ def set_background(image_path):
|
|
| 28 |
|
| 29 |
bg_image_style = f"""
|
| 30 |
<style>
|
| 31 |
-
.stApp {{
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| 32 |
background-image: url("data:image/png;base64,{encoded_img}");
|
| 33 |
-
background-size:
|
| 34 |
background-repeat: no-repeat;
|
| 35 |
-
background-attachment: fixed;
|
| 36 |
background-position: center;
|
| 37 |
filter: blur(6px); /* 60% blur effect */
|
|
|
|
| 38 |
}}
|
| 39 |
</style>
|
| 40 |
"""
|
| 41 |
st.markdown(bg_image_style, unsafe_allow_html=True)
|
| 42 |
|
| 43 |
# Update the image path
|
| 44 |
-
set_background("
|
| 45 |
|
| 46 |
# Initialize stopwords and lemmatizer
|
| 47 |
stop_words = set(stopwords.words('english')).union({"pm"})
|
|
|
|
| 9 |
from nltk.corpus import stopwords
|
| 10 |
from nltk.stem import WordNetLemmatizer
|
| 11 |
# Download necessary resources
|
| 12 |
+
nltk.download('punkt')
|
| 13 |
nltk.download('stopwords')
|
| 14 |
nltk.download('wordnet')
|
| 15 |
|
|
|
|
| 28 |
|
| 29 |
bg_image_style = f"""
|
| 30 |
<style>
|
| 31 |
+
.stApp::before {{
|
| 32 |
+
content: "";
|
| 33 |
+
position: fixed;
|
| 34 |
+
top: 0;
|
| 35 |
+
left: 0;
|
| 36 |
+
width: 100%;
|
| 37 |
+
height: 100%;
|
| 38 |
background-image: url("data:image/png;base64,{encoded_img}");
|
| 39 |
+
background-size: cover;
|
| 40 |
background-repeat: no-repeat;
|
|
|
|
| 41 |
background-position: center;
|
| 42 |
filter: blur(6px); /* 60% blur effect */
|
| 43 |
+
z-index: -1;
|
| 44 |
}}
|
| 45 |
</style>
|
| 46 |
"""
|
| 47 |
st.markdown(bg_image_style, unsafe_allow_html=True)
|
| 48 |
|
| 49 |
# Update the image path
|
| 50 |
+
set_background("page/News image 2.png") # Ensure the image is in the correct folder
|
| 51 |
|
| 52 |
# Initialize stopwords and lemmatizer
|
| 53 |
stop_words = set(stopwords.words('english')).union({"pm"})
|